当前位置: 首页 > 知识库问答 >
问题:

如何将函数的输出放入DataFrame中?[副本]

仉宸
2023-03-14
def sentiment_analyzer_scores(sentence):
    for sentence in df['clean_text']:
        score =analyser.polarity_scores(sentence)

        print({<40{}".format(sentence,str(score)))

print(sentiment_analyzer_scores(df['clean_text'])

共有1个答案

宣望
2023-03-14

通常,可以通过以下方式创建新列:

import pandas as pd
df = pd.DataFrame({'col':['hello', 'bye']})
df['len'] = df['col'].apply(len)
print(df)

产出:

     col  len
0  hello    5
1    bye    3

在你的情况下,我认为这样的事情应该奏效:

df['new_column'] = df['clean_text'].apply(analyser.polarity_scores)
df['new_column'] = df['clean_text'].apply(lambda x:"{}<40{}".format(x, str(analyser.polarity_scores(x))))
 类似资料:
  • 以下程序的目的是将4个字符的单词从转换为,我已经完成了让该列表和len工作的困难部分。 问题是程序逐行输出答案,我想知道是否有任何方法可以将输出存储回列表,并将其作为一个完整的句子打印出来? 谢谢

  • 我在OS Sierra上运行Python3.5.2。我已经安装了selenium,我正在阅读一本名为“用Python自动化无聊的任务”的书。 我的密码是 我一直收到错误 我已经广泛地寻找解决我的问题的方法。很多人都有同样的问题。但没有一个解决方案奏效。我已经在我的Python文件夹中到处复制了geckodriver。我试过使用terminal,也试过在代码中指定路径,但它仍然给我错误。我希望有人能

  • 问题内容: 快速问题(我希望!):如果我使用\ i将输入文件输入到psql中,是否可以从查询中获取输出以保存到文件中?如果是这样,怎么办?谢谢!! 问题答案: 根据文档,用于将输出定向到文件。

  • 我有一个包含3000多条记录的数据框架,其中包括每次观测的经纬度坐标。我想从每一组坐标中得到国家和州或省。 或者,一个更好的解决我的问题,获得空间信息是赞赏的! 下面是我的代码:

  • 我正在通过API向另一个服务发送HTTP Post请求以创建订单。问题是,它需要数组中的一些HTTP参数。 这些是我现在使用的参数: 我需要补充一点: 这是直接从我使用的服务留档。问题是标题:{...}。 我尝试使用不同的数组格式,如下所示: 在这种情况下,我相信很容易进入...= 我能在这里做什么?谢谢